Known throughout the world as a focal point of the civil rights movement, Little Rock Central High is also known as the "Most Beautiful High School in America." Even if you think you know the story of the 1957 integration crisis, it's worth a visit to the National Park Service Visitor's Center. Call in advance for weekday tours - they are by reservation only and often fill up quickly! The Arkansas State Capitol is one of our favorite places to visit and learn. Not only the seat of government for The Natural State, it is a beautiful example of Neo-Classical architecture. Tours are on weekdays from 9-3, but get there early if visiting while the legislature is in session because parking can be quite limited! (Tour info here: https://www.sos.arkansas.gov/state-capitol/state-capitol-tour-information) Fun fact: The Arkansas Capitol building is so similar to the US Capitol that it is often used in movies. During the filming of one movie, the dome was stained black during the fake "bombing" of the building, and it remained that way for a long time.

Right next door to the Clinton Center is Heifer Village and Urban Farm. It is the international headquarters of Heifer International, a nonprofit organization that works with impoverished communities throughout the world to establish sustainable farming and livestock practices. They donate animals (bees, fish, chicken, livestock, etc.) to locals and provide ongoing training and resources for success. The hallmark of their program is the idea that recipients "Pass On" the gift, meaning that if they have received from Heifer, they will then donate to someone else.
